J'aimerai savoir comment on fait sur VBA pour supprimer l'en tête d'un tableau qui se répète plusieurs fois ainsi que les cellules vide?
comme dans mon fichier "onglet récap" pour ne plus avoir que les donnés.
Je veux repartir de cet onglet qui sera mis automatiquement à jour grâce à la macro.
Votre idée est intéressante mais cela veut dire créer d'autre feuille or j'aimerai optimiser la saisie....
je veux donc une macro qui reprend onglet récap mais qui me supprime, les en tête répétitive et les lignes vide pour former une base de données .
Voici mon début de code
Sub basedonnées()
Sheets("Récap par marchés").Select
Range("A1:V5000").Select
Selection.Copy
Sheets("Feuil2").Select
Range("A1").Select
ActiveSheet.Paste
Rows("9:200").Select
Selection.RowHeight = 20
Columns("A").Select
Selection.ColumnWidth = 25
Columns("B").Select
Selection.ColumnWidth = 57
Columns("C:O").Select
Selection.ColumnWidth = 25
Columns("P").Select
Selection.ColumnWidth = 40
Columns("Q:W").Select
Selection.ColumnWidth = 25
Columns("c").Delete ' ces colonnes ne m'intéresse pas
Columns("h").Delete
Columns("k:q").Delete
Columns("l:m").Delete
Sheets("Feuil2").Select
Cells.UnMerge
(ici je veux supprimer les lignes et en tête)
End Sub
Merci encore pour votre aide.
CDt